Traditionally, sweat lodges are constructed using a circular framework made of saplings and covered with blankets or animal hides. The interior is meticulously prepared with hot stones placed in the center, symbolizing the Earth’s energy. The ceremony is led by an experienced spiritual leader, known as a shaman or medicine person.Heading 3: The Ritual Process of a Sweat Lodge CeremonyA sweat lodge ceremony typically consists of several rounds, each representing a different aspect of the spiritual journey. Participants gather inside the lodge, sitting in a circle, and the entrance is sealed to create an intimate and sacred environment. The shaman pours water onto the heated stones, which releases steam, generating intense heat and darkness within the lodge. This darkness represents the womb of Mother Earth, offering a transformative experience.Heading 4: Purification and Healing Benefits of the Sweat Lodge CeremonyThe heat and steam generated during the sweat lodge ceremony have profound physical and spiritual benefits.
